Cartesian Form for Vector Formulation

1.3K
The Cartesian form for vector formulation is a process to calculateĀ  the moment of force using the position and force vectors. The moment of force is defined as the cross-product of these vectors, making it a vector quantity. The Cartesian form of the position and force vectors involves unit vectors, which can be used to express the cross-product in determinant form.

Chemical Formulas

52.2K
A chemical formula presents information about the proportions of atoms constituting a particular chemical compound or molecule, mainly using symbols of elements and numbers. At times other symbols, such as dashes, parentheses, brackets, commas, plus, and minus signs, are also used. A chemical formula can be one of three types – molecular, empirical, and structural.

Molecular Compounds: Formulas and Nomenclature

45.7K
Molecular compounds or covalent compounds result when atoms share electrons to form covalent bonds. Since there is no electron transfer, molecular compounds do not contain ions; instead, they consist of discrete, neutral molecules.

Formulation for beginners.

Rob Selzer1, Steven Ellen2

  • 1Director Clinical Teaching MBBS, Central Clinical School, Monash University and Alfred Health; Consultant Psychiatrist at Alfred Health; Monash Alfred Psychiatry Research Centre, Central Clinical School, Monash University, Melbourne, VIC, Australia r.selzer@alfred.org.au.

Australasian Psychiatry : Bulletin of Royal Australian and New Zealand College of Psychiatrists
|May 31, 2014
PubMed
Summary

This study offers a straightforward framework to simplify the psychological formulation process for beginners. It aims to make developing a formulation accessible and less daunting for new practitioners.
